WebbSapalta Cherry-Plum (Chum) Brooks, Alberta 1941 ~ open pollinated seeding of Sapa (P.pumila x P.salicina 'Sultan' ~ N.E. Hansen, S.D. 1908) ... Tree grows to six feet and will spread to 8ft or more. Hansen quote (old Seed Savers article) "All the sand cherry hybrids should be kept in bush form with many stems close to the ground. WebbSapalta Cherry-Plum is a large shrub that is typically grown for its edible qualities. It produces purple round fruit (technically 'drupes') with red overtones and deep purple flesh which are usually ready for picking in late summer. Note that the fruits have hard inedible pits inside which must be removed before eating or processing. http://plants.landsburgnursery.com/12060002/Plant/1142/Sapalta_Cherry-Plum WebbThe cherry plum is a popular ornamental tree for garden and landscaping use, grown for its very early flowering. WebbHeight: 2.5m (8 FT.) Spread: 1.5 - 2m (5 - 6 ) A cherry/plum cross. Red-purple, bitter skin and purple-black, sweet, semi-clingstone flesh. Ripens in late summer. WebbSapalta Cherry-Plum will grow to be about 15 feet tall at maturity, with a spread of 10 feet. It tends to be a little leggy, with a typical clearance of 2 feet from the ground, and is suitable for planting under power lines.

Cherry plum is a broadleaf deciduous tree and one of the first Prunus species to flower in spring. It can grow to 8m. Its bark is dark grey and develops fissures with age, and its twigs are green and covered in a fine down when young.
